2/14 Chapter: The Statement of Allâh: But, if they repent and perform Iqâmat-As-Salat [offer (prayers) perfectly] and give Zakât [1] then leave their way free." (V. 9:5).
باب: فَإِنْ تَابُوا وَأَقَامُوا الصَّلَاةَ وآتَوُا الزَّكَاةَ فَخَلُّوا سَبِيلَهُمْ
[1] Zakât: A certain fixed proportion of the wealth and of the each and every kind of the property liable to Zaltht of a Muslim to be paid yearly for the benefit of the poor in the Muslim community. The payment of Zakát is obligatory as it is one of the five pillars of Islam. Zakát is the major economic means for establishing social justice and leading the Muslim society to prosperity and security. [See Sahih Al-Bukhári, Vol. 2, Book of Zakát (24)].

Narrated Ibn 'Abbas

Two women who were stitching shoes in a house fought each other. One of them came out with an awl driven into her hand, and she sued the other for it. The case was brought before Ibn 'Abbâs. Ibn Abbâs said, "Allâh's Messenger (ﷺ) said, 'If people were to be given what they claim (without proving their claim) the life and property of the nation would be lost. ' Will you remind her (i.e. the defendant), of Allâh and recite before her: ' Verily, those who purchase a small gain at the cost of Allâh's Covenant and their oaths.... ' " (V.3:77). So they reminded her and she confessed. Ibn 'Abbâs then said, The Prophet (ﷺ) said, 'The oath is to be taken by the defendant (in the absence of any proof against him). ' " ' [6:74-O.B]
